<p>As with his predecessors, who each year since 2003 are voted by the public out of a group selected by journalists, the Brazilian will have his footprints cast on the Champions Promenade on the seafront of the principality of Monaco.<br /><br />The award boosts the morale of the 29-year-old international, who has gone through an indifferent spell with Milan as the Serie A giants look for their best form in the early part of the season. During his five-year stint at Barcelona, Ronaldinho won the FIFA World Player award in 2004 and 2005. In the latter year he also received the Ballon d'Or award.</p>
